Other studies have explained purposes of having a will beyond the distribution of financial assets. Rossi and Rossi (1990) studied wills and inheritances in the context of family relationships and identified wills as the primary method of handling the transfer not only of valuable financial items, but also of personal possessions in order to manage family relationships after death. Stum (2021) examined nontitled property transfers, arguing that inheritance is not simply an economic or legal issue, but one with plex emotional and family relationship dimensions. Schwartz (1993) also explored the legal and family influences on having a will, arguing that wills are also an expression of individualism, and a reflection of the individual’s relationship with family and munity at the time of writing the will. A study by Rosenfeld (1992) argues that due to changing demographics, wills increasingly are tools for designating guardians of grandchildren who are in their custody, or designating care givers for older dependent children. These studies provide insights into how financial wills can work as a multifunction tool for postdeath resource allocations. Advance directives for health care have been developed as a mechanism for enhancing the rights of individual patients, clarifying patient preference for medical care, and protecting both patients and surrogate decision makers from legal liability for health care decisions at the EOL (Emanuel et al. 2021). For example, the Living Will allows persons to specify, in writing, their preferences for medical care to be followed when they themselves are no longer able to articulate their own The Durable Power of Attorney for Health Care (DPAHC) is a legal document that allows a person to designate another individual to make medical decisions for them if they are unable to do so. Furthermore, psychological preparations such as indepth discussions with family members on preferences of health care treatments, personal beliefs, values and desires, have been encouraged by government agencies and health professionals (Goebel and Crave 1994).
